html
<script type="text/javascript" src="/js/prototype.js"></script> <script type="text/javascript" src="/js/scriptaculous.js?load=effects"></script> <script type="text/javascript" src="/js/lightbox.js"></script> <a href="/photos/warehouse/20070210_1756.jpg" rel="lightbox" title="photo shot">とりあえずrelを指定してwarehouseに置いている画像にリンク</a>
と、
思ったけど、一度編集画面開いて、そのまま登録すれば元に戻るのか。
今、
気がついたんだけど、(グループ日記から)エキスポートして、(ダイアリーに)インポートすると ' (シングルクォート)が ' に変換されちゃうんですね〜。直すの面倒だなあ。
あと、
コレ書くまでに3回エラー画面が出て、その都度ゼロから入力してました。
ショックで立ち直れそうにありません・・・。
移設
今迄、garden.g.hatena.ne.jp/Kur に置いていたものをこちらに移設。向こうは削除しました。
グループを削除(解散)する方法がわからないので、gardenグループはそのままですが、使用したい方がいらっしゃいましたら管理者権をお渡しいたします。また、(管理者権限が私に有る状態での)グループの使用ははてなの利用規約に照らしてご自由に。
なおこちらはソースコードのメモ用。
本拠地は、http://wiki.wiir.jp/2jun/ です。
3Dモデリングツール Metasequoia(メタセコイア)のプラグインは以下の場所で公開しています。
javascript
// ==UserScript== // @name LDR keybind for LDR // @namespace http://ma.la/ // @description simple keybind for livedoor reader // @include http://reader.livedoor.com/reader/ // ==/UserScript== new function(){ var w = unsafeWindow; w.register_hook('AFTER_INIT', function(){ GM_addStyle('.fs-focus{background-color:#888;color:#fff !important}'); GM_addStyle('#right_body,#subs_body{bodrder:2px solid #fff}'); with(w){ register_hook('AFTER_PRINTFEED', function(){ State.focus_subscribe_id = State.now_reading; }); function get_next_from(sid){ var list = Ordered.list; if(!list) return; var offset = list.indexOfStr(sid); var next = list[offset+1]; return next; } function get_prev_from(sid){ var list = Ordered.list; if(!list) return; var offset = list.indexOfStr(sid); var prev = list[offset-1]; return prev; } var state = 0; function subs_focus(id, e){ var el = $('subs_item_' + id); if(!el) return; SubsItem.onhover.call(el,e) if(Config.view_mode != "flat"){ var tvroot = QueryCSS.findParent(function(){ return /^treeview/.test(this.id) }, el); var tv = TreeView.get_control(tvroot.id); tv && tv.open() } var sc = $("subs_container"); sc.scrollTop = el.offsetTop - $("subs_container").offsetTop - 64; sc.scrollLeft = 0; } function subs_unfocus(id,e){ var el = $('subs_item_' + id); if(!el) return; SubsItem.onunhover.call(el, e); } Control.scan_up = function(e){ var current = State.focus_subscribe_id || State.now_reading; var prev = get_prev_from(current); if(prev){ if(current){ subs_unfocus(current, e) } subs_focus(prev, e); State.focus_subscribe_id = prev; } }; Control.scan_down = function(e){ var current = State.focus_subscribe_id || State.now_reading; var next = get_next_from(current); if(next){ if(current){ subs_unfocus(current, e) } subs_focus(next, e); State.focus_subscribe_id = next; } }; Keybind.add('left', function(){ state = 0; setStyle('subs_body', { border : '2px dotted #99f' }); setStyle('right_body', { border : '2px solid #fff' }) }); Keybind.add('right', function(){ if(state == 1){ Control.pin(); return } if(state == 0){ state = 1; if(State.focus_subscribe_id){ Control.read(State.focus_subscribe_id, Control.prefetch); } setStyle('subs_body', { border : '2px solid #fff' }); setStyle('right_body', { border : '2px dotted #99f' }) } }); Keybind.add('down', function(){ if(state == 1){ Control.go_next(); return } Control.scan_down(); }); Keybind.add('up', function(){ if(state == 1){ Control.go_prev(); return } Control.scan_up(); }); } }); }